Transaction 669dd29e0dd8b2bdbe87229a98ac973c895963e3a52b6a3fd2fad8741a495524
1 Input
1 Output
-
669dd29e0dd8b2bdbe87229a98ac973c895963e3a52b6a3fd2fad8741a495524:0
- value
- 2504667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e44b90ea038b09b038c698a49513410805446225 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mp7bAHAmX1waRjbfwowMzqyKx6fzZ8Tx3